Peppermint Oreo Cookie Balls

These four ingredient Peppermint Oreo Cookie Balls are the perfect Christmas no bake treat! Easy, great for holiday parties and such a tasty chocolate and mint flavor!

You can add or substitute with these ingredients:


  • use any flavor Oreo cookies
  • use candy canes instead of starlight mints
  • use sprinkles instead of starlight mints
  • sprinkle mints on top instead of coating them

Peppermint Oreo Cookie Balls

Ingredients

  • 1 - 14.3 ounce package Oreos
  • 8 ounces cream cheese
  • 1 - 10 ounce bag Peppermint Starlight Mints
  • 1 - 10 ounce bag Ghirardelli white chocolate melting wafers

Instructions

  1. In a blender or food processor, add the oreo cookies four to five cookies at a time. Blend and add to a mixing bowl. Do this for the full package of cookies.
  2. Add cream cheese to the bowl. Mix well with a hand mixer. Roll mix into about one tablespoon size balls. Place on a plate and store in the fridge for one hour.
  3. Meanwhile, place peppermint candies into a bag and crush well with a kitchen mallet or rolling pin. Pour into a bowl.
  4. After one hour, remove the oreo balls from the fridge.
  5. Melt the white chocolate wafers as directed on the bag in a microwave safe bowl. Once melted, dip the oreo balls into the white chocolate then into the crushed peppermints.
  6. Place on parchment paper until dry. Serve or store in the refrigerator in an airtight container for up to a week.
